日期:2014-05-19  浏览次数:20769 次

SQL语句问题啊~(简单极了)C#
我写了一个用户登陆系统~现在问题是这样的
在用户输入了用户名秘密符合后,就查询这个表中这一行的另一字段的内容,并保存下来~谢谢~
例如:数据库表如下
users             name                   password                
123                   kk                       123456
456                   jj                       456789
现在登陆成功~要获取users这一行的name字段的内容,就是“kk”,然后保存到字符串ss中~
再次谢谢

------解决方案--------------------
this.oleDbConnection1.Open();
this.oleDbDataAdapter1.Fill(dataSet21.Users);
foreach(DataRow mytable in this.dataSet21.Tables[ "Users "].Rows)
{
if(mytable[ "UserName "].ToString()==this.textBox1.Text.Trim()&&mytable[ "UserPassWord "].ToString()==this.textBox2.Text.Trim())
{b=true;}
string kk= "UserName ";

}

只供参考,有些和你做时的代码不同
方法基本是这样
------解决方案--------------------
你这样子要操作两次数据库,没必要
select [name] from t1 where users= '123 ' and password= '123456 '
这样就ok
有的话说明登录成功,取到的就是name
没有的话说名登录失败

一次就够了